GFORCE는 보상 비율을 조정할 수 있는 무마찰 패시브 이자 토큰으로, 이중 잔액 테이블을 사용하여 거래를 여러 엔드포인트로 분할하여 GFORCE 보유자가 자동으로 보상을 받을 수 있도록 합니다. 마찰 없는 패시브 수익률은 가스가 필요 없는 안전한 수익률 생성기입니다. 패시브 수익률은 3%의 거래세로 달성되며, 이 수수료는 자동으로 GFCE 보유자에게 분배됩니다. 이러한 조치는 온체인 거래량이 있는 한 모든 GFORCE 보유자가 수동적으로 GFORCE를 획득할 수 있도록 보장합니다. 표준 패시브 수수료는 자동으로 보상되며, 사용자가 더 많은 지포스를 얻기 위해 하베스팅이나 컨트랙트 거래를 할 필요가 없습니다. 자동화된 시장 메이커(AMM)의 다른 토큰과 유동성 풀에 있는 동안에도 G포스 수수료를 받을 수 있습니다. 따라서 다양한 방법으로 지포스를 통해 추가 수익을 얻을 수 있습니다.

Robotics Gains in U.S. Homebuilding Come From Narrower Uses, Not Humanoid Robots
Robotics Gains in U.S. Homebuilding Come From Narrower Uses, Not Humanoid Robots
According to CNBC, U.S. homebuilders are turning to robotics and automation to ease labor shortages, but the biggest productivity gains so far are coming from targeted tools such as layout systems, error-prevention machines and factory-based construction rather than humanoid robots on job sites. The National Association of Home Builders said the United States is short roughly 1.2 million homes, nearly 300,000 construction jobs were open at the end of 2025, and the industry needs to attract about 740,000 workers a year to keep up with growth, retirements and departures. NAHB chief economist Robert Dietz said residential construction productivity has risen only about 16% since 1993, while labor shortages cost homebuilders about $11 billion a year and add roughly two months to average construction timelines. Industry experts said construction remains difficult to automate because every site changes daily and projects vary in design, soil conditions, subcontractors and materials. Dusty Robotics founder Tessa Lau said the company’s FieldPrinter prints digital plans directly onto floors to help multiple trades work from the same layout, while Dusty says one operator can lay out about 10,000 to 15,000 square feet a day, up to 10 times faster than traditional methods. Skanska reported a 75% reduction in rework and a 35% reduction in its layout schedule after using Dusty’s multi-trade system. Aaron Love, president and CEO of Oh Snap Layout, said combining robotic layout with prefabricated wall panels and other off-site methods cut shell construction from about 21 days to 11 to 12 days. The article said Japan has become a leader in residential construction robotics, with developers building 80% of a home by robots inside factories before final assembly on site. Kawasaki Robotics said industrial robots at one factory lifted production from 55 to 65 housing units a day while reducing operators by 20, and Sekisui Heim estimates the investment will pay for itself in about three years. Patrick Murphy, chief investment officer of Coastal Construction and managing director of Renco USA, said factory-built components can reduce schedules by roughly 30% to 40%, but he does not expect skilled construction workers to disappear.

Market News | Two-Year Yield Jumps to 4.61% as Traders Price a Near-Certain Hike, 10-Year Stays Flat
Market News | Two-Year Yield Jumps to 4.61% as Traders Price a Near-Certain Hike, 10-Year Stays Flat
US inflation came in broadly in line with estimates in August, but the core rate rose faster than expected, putting a Fed hike next week firmly on the table.Headline CPI rose 0.4% on the month against forecasts of 0.4% and July's 0.1%. Year-over-year it rose 3.4%, matching both expectations and July's reading.Core CPI increased 0.3% month over month, faster than the 0.2% forecast and July's 0.2%. Annual core inflation came in at 2.4%, in line with expectations and down from July's 2.5%.The two-year Treasury yield jumped six basis points to 4.61% as traders began assigning nearly a 100% chance of a hike next week. The 10-year, less closely tied to Fed policy, was flat at 4.95%.Bitcoin dipped back to $76,700 in the minutes following the release and trades at $77,320. Nasdaq 100 futures rose to a session high, up 0.8%.The Curve Flattened, Which Is the Market's Verdict on CredibilityThe divergence between the two maturities is the most informative part of the reaction.A six basis point move in the two-year with the 10-year unchanged means traders repriced the Fed's near-term path without changing their view of longer-term inflation or term premium. The curve flattened.That combination reads as the market treating a hike as sufficient rather than insufficient. A Fed seen as behind the curve would push long yields higher alongside short ones, because persistent inflation would be priced into the out years. A Fed seen as responding adequately gets the opposite — short rates up, long rates anchored.Nasdaq futures rising to session highs on the same print is consistent with that reading. Equities are not selling a hike they believe contains the problem.Bond Markets Flipped From No Hikes to 75 Basis Points in Two WeeksThe scale of the repricing since Jackson Hole is the context that makes this print consequential.Traders moved from assuming no rate hikes — potentially for the rest of 2026 — to hedging against as much as 75 basis points of tightening this year.That sent the 10-year from the 4.60% area to just shy of 5.00% ahead of Friday's data. The two-year rose from 4.20% to 4.56% before the numbers, then to 4.61% after.A 41 basis point move in the policy-sensitive maturity across two weeks, on no actual policy change, describes a market rebuilding its entire view of the year from a single speech.Warsh Created the Conditions He Argued AgainstThe August report took on outsized importance after Chair Kevin Warsh hinted at Jackson Hole that the Fed might have to act if inflation did not soon show signs of slowing.Bond markets have been in a fever pitch since.That outcome inverts what Warsh intended. He used the speech to reject forward guidance, arguing the practice has "overstayed its welcome" outside genuine crises and that quasi-commitments inhibit the Fed's freedom to decide correctly. He committed to "a discipline, not to a decision."The Wall Street Journal's Nick Timiraos identified the consequence: the speech convinced investors a hike was likelier without telling them what would trigger one, leaving a single data release to authorize the decision.Markets filled the gap themselves, and the magnitude they filled it with — 75 basis points — exceeds anything Warsh signalled.Forecasters Have Converged on Three HikesBank of America expects 25 basis points next week with another 50 by year-end. RBC Capital Markets revised from rate cuts this year to three hikes. Both arrive at 75 basis points of total tightening.Fitch Ratings' Olu Sonola said the data make it "increasingly difficult to justify a pause."Rates have sat at 3.50%-3.75% since December 2025, making a September increase the first since July 2023. With the move now priced near certainty, the dot plot and updated projections carry the information rather than the decision itself.The Asymmetry Sits on the Other SideLMAX Group's Joel Kruger flagged what near-certain pricing implies for the reaction function."A good deal of the hawkish risk is arguably priced in," he said. "We see greater potential for an outsized move in risk assets to the topside should the Fed ultimately fail to deliver on these hawkish expectations."At nearly 100% priced, a hike delivers confirmation. A hold delivers a shock.Bitcoin's intraday path illustrates how that logic already played out on the data. It fell to $76,700 immediately after the release, then rebounded above $79,000 as the uncertainty around the decision collapsed, before settling at $77,320.21Shares' Matt Mena noted Bitcoin has gained an average 2.13% over the 30 days following hotter-than-expected core CPI readings, though the current combination of an energy shock and yields near 5% is not typical of prior instances.The Energy Shock Runs Underneath All of ItBrent closed at $104.61, up more than 8% on the week.Saudi Arabia closed the East-West pipeline that bypasses the Strait of Hormuz, and Houthi attacks hit Saudi energy facilities. Production fell to 6.238 million barrels per day, the lowest since 1990 — a producer that cannot export cannot sustain output.Headline CPI at 3.4% against core at 2.4% shows that gap directly, and it is the reason the flat 10-year matters. The market is pricing the energy component as a level shift rather than an embedded inflation problem.The Clarity Act cloture vote falls September 15. The Fed decides September 16 at 2:00 p.m. ET.
